“Dynamite” Dave Davis Continues 50-Lap Dominance
By Rick Anges

David Davis Wins Tough Bomber 50 Lap Event

Bradenton, Fl. - DeSoto Super Speedway would not only host a full card of racing action on the night but also U.S. Congresswoman Katherine Harris. Harris who was at the speedway not only to support her upcoming election for the Senate but was also sponsoring one the drivers in the Open Wheel class Bill Davis.

Harris who was interviewed on the front stretch was asked if she has ever been to the speedway before, "I have never been here before but I am having such a great time I'll be back". Harris proved the point by talking to almost every fan in the stands.

The night's racing started off with qualifying for three classes. In the Bomber division 50 lap shoot out it was Randy Johnson taking the fast time and the extra $100 put up by Richard Markow from Gulf Coast Auto Parts. Following him was Jerome Slideways Watland, Milena Firestine, James Crawford Jr. and Radical Rick Germony.

The Rocketman Wayne Jefferson took the fast time for the 75 lap feature in the Q-Auto and Injury Open Wheel Modifieds, second fast was Tate Pierce the John Sarppriacone Jr. in his first race of the season followed by 04 Champ Bobby Baldwin and Wayne Bowman.

Twenty-eight cars rolled out onto the speedway for the 50-lap Bomber shoot-out. The roll of the die inverted the field the full six rows putting Dave Davis and Robert Shaver on the front row.

One of the crowd favorites Jerome 'Slideways' Watland encountered problems early with a flat tire. Watland would make his way back out onto the track but he would finish several laps down in the twenty-first spot.

The racing was wild as always with three and four wide through out the field. Positions were being swapped but up front Davis was showing his patience and dominance in the fifty lap events. Davis was the winner in last years shoot-out. Davis was never really challenged throughout the event but behind him the competition was hot and heavy.

Robert Shaver had a strong run going in the second spot but it wasnt long before team mates Pistol Pete Barr and Radical Rick Germony made their way through the field and by the second place Shaver. The team dueled back and forth for the spot.

When the smoke cleared and the checkers flew it was Davis taking his second shoot-out win in as many years, Germony moved up and took second, third was Barr, fourth went to The Punsher Michael Crooks and fifth went to fast qualifier Randy Johnson.

"I just want to thank all the guys in this class, it wasnt long ago that flipped this car and everyone got together and helped me get it back out in a week", said a choked up Davis in the winners circle.

Q-Auto and Injury Open Wheel Modifieds:
A zero came up on the roll of the die and field took the green the way they qualified. Wayne Jefferson driving the number 61 of Chet Senkossoff jumped out to the lead with Tae Pierce in the second spot.

John Sarppraicone Jr. who had spent last season running the Hooters Pro Cup series wasted no time and got around Pierce and set his sites on the leader.

A crash on the backstretch ended the night for Bill Davis as coming out of turn two had no where to go and slammed into two cars who had spun in front of him.

Also involved in violent crash was Wayne Bowman who had a solid top five run going when he got caught up in a crash on the front stretch. Getting caught up with Eric Rudd, going airborne and nearly going into the catch fence. Bowman was able to walk away from the wreck but his car went off on the hook.

The racing up front was heating up as Sarppraicones car closed in on Jefferson in every turn.

But his run for the top spot would end in turn two as bump sent Jefferson around in a cloud of smoke sending Sarppraicone to the rear of the field. He would climb back up and finish in the sixth spot.

Jefferson would take the green to checkers win, second was Tate Pierce, in a solid run Mike Hingardner finished third, fourth was Mark Nelson and fifth Sean McLaughlin.

Florida Mini-Stock Challenge Series:
The Florida Mini-Stock Challenge Series was in town and Robbie Storer, who has had his share of laps and wins at DeSoto, came out on top and took fast time.

Robbie Storer and Ronnie Larson had the fans on their feet as they battled for the lead in the fifty-lap FMSC race but the two got together and spun sending both cars to the rear of the field.

Chris Thornton was the Lucky Dog in fray as he took win and increased his lead in the points race in the series, second went to Robbie Yoakam, third was Ray Folwell, fourth Ronnie Larson and fifth Chuck Frazier.
